CID seeking volunteer for board vacancy

The Columbia Irrigation District is looking for people interested in filing an existing board vacancy for Division 3.

Board member James Berger recently sold his property in the district and is ineligible to serve on the five-member board.

Board members serve three-year terms. The person appointed will fill Berger's term, which expires Dec. 31.

Division 3 covers the area from Washington Street east to South Oak Street.

The CID board meets the first Tuesday of each month, and board members are unpaid volunteers.

Anyone interested in applying for the position must submit a letter of interest stating their qualifications and proof of being a property owner in District 3 before 5 p.m. Jan. 23.

A special board meeting at 11 a.m. Jan. 24 at CID offices, 10 E. Kennewick Ave., will review applications and select a preferred candidate.

Appointments are made by the Benton County commissioners.
